My childhood was spent in California.

Where I lived it snowed exactly one time during my childhood. Us kids were ecstatic.

Except me.

I was sick.

Mom wouldn’t let me go outside.

Fifty-two years later, I live in an area where snow is common.

In fact it’s snowing now.

And I don’t really want to go outside.

But there’s still something special about snow.

The world is clothed in white under a coat of billions of snowflakes, each unique.

The complexity of weather is mind boggling. Even the greatest minds have trouble predicting it accurately.

But the mind of God created it.

I’d say that’s a good reason to bring God praise.

And there are many more good reasons.
